How do you say "marathon" in Korean?
마라톤
maraton
In Korean, "marathon" is 마라톤 (maraton).

Example sentence
그녀는 마라톤을 달리기 위해 몇 달간 훈련했다.
geunyeoneun maratoneul dalrigi wihae myeot dalgan hunryeonhaetda.
She trained for months to run the marathon.

Is 마라톤 formal or casual?
마라톤 is a neutral, everyday word that works in both casual and polite speech. The level of formality comes from the sentence structure around it, not from the word itself.
